How the Network Works

Through the Sustainable States Network, members learn, share successes, support each other, and access resources to enhance their state and regional programs while addressing challenges.

As a peer-learning network focused on making sustainability the norm, we focus on:

Driving collective impact

- Mobilizing action across hundreds of cities

- Collaborating on shared projects to increase the impact of individual programs

Centering equity and shared learning

- Prioritizing social equity in our work

- Fostering new areas of sustainable development practice

Providing tools and visibility

- Developing shared tools and resources for local governments

- Sharing evaluation tools to accelerate success

- Creating visibility and a unified voice for municipally-focused work and impact

- Educating funders and national policy makers
